Transaction 4111d309020816cf995b75071588cc2302685c3709e04bd22616009e6ebb299c

1 Input
2 Outputs
  • 4111d309020816cf995b75071588cc2302685c3709e04bd22616009e6ebb299c:0
  • value  27646381
    address  38DBwpZxodiUE1xqn1wV1cmWgCxZ2reE4p
  • 4111d309020816cf995b75071588cc2302685c3709e04bd22616009e6ebb299c:1
  • value  2598090
    address  1BCLQ5q7mojogMV6L3ZdCpkxyerrYXBEB4